The number of phone calls between two cities, N, during a given time period varies the directly as the populations p1 and p2 of the two cities and inversely as the distance, d, between them. If 36,000 calls are made between two cities 310 miles apart and the populations of the cities are 31,000 and a 180,000, how many calls are made between two cities with populations of 80,000 and a 150,000 that are 485 miles apart?
